alynn | MEMORY FROM 2007

The Red Headed Stranger

LOCATION: Cypress Gardens , Florida

YEAR: 2007

TAGS: legends, roadshow, outlaws

PUBLISHED: March 3, 2008

For a country music fan seeing Willie Nelson in concert is a treat you will never forget.  His career has been phenomenal to say the least.  His lifestyle and exploits, like him, are legendary.  Even if you have never met him, most everyone knows more about his life than they do their neighbors.  In February of 2007 Willie appeared at Cypress Gardens in Florida.  My husband and I were there.  Although no longer young, we were not disappointed.  For almost two hours we were treated to his genius with music though old songs and new.
 There are too many great Willie songs to nail one down as a favorite.  However, for me On the Road Again will always be the one that reminds me of the day I saw Willie in person.  From the buses out back to the four stands of Willie souvenirs it was a road show all the way.
 The park was packed with Willie fans—getting into the bathroom alone took thirty minutes, and food lines went on forever.  Many sported the usual T-shirts and such touting their adoration of this man.  Some went further by donning his trademark bandana with the braid hanging down the back (they sold those for a mere twenty dollars).  Youngsters to senior citizens claimed their seats and waited even through a brief shower to hear him sing.  It was well worth the wait to see and hear the Red Headed Stranger live.
